Bill Summary
AN ACT TO PROVIDE FUNDS FOR THE PURCHASE OF A BUILDING IN WINSTON-SALEM FOR THE UNIVERSITY OF NORTH CAROLINA SCHOOL OF THE ARTS.
AI Summary
This bill appropriates $4.5 million in nonrecurring funds from the General Fund to the University of North Carolina Board of Trustees for the purpose of purchasing a specific piece of real estate located at 411 W. 4th Street in Winston-Salem, which is adjacent to the Stevens Center. The bill specifically notes that this appropriation is being made despite existing statutes (G.S. 143C-5-2 and Article 6 of Chapter 146) that might typically govern such expenditures, indicating a special legislative allocation. The funds are designated for the 2025-2026 fiscal year, and the act will become effective on July 1, 2025. By providing this specific funding, the bill aims to enable the University of North Carolina School of the Arts to expand its physical infrastructure by acquiring the neighboring property, which could potentially support the school's educational facilities or future development plans.
